Dodoomchit is a browser-based audio utility that helps users inspect music files directly in their own environment. Instead of sending audio to an external server, the tool is designed to work in the browser, giving users a fast way to review track characteristics such as probable genre direction, approximate BPM by tapping, duration, file size, simple key hints, and real-time spectrum behavior. For creators working on short-form video, beat drafting, demo review, music study, podcast editing, remix preparation, or quick reference analysis, this kind of lightweight workflow can save time and reduce friction.
